Master programme
Sustainable Energy Systems - SES
The Master programme "Sustainable Energy Systems - SES" aspires to deliver excellent scientific training and know-how, as well as comprehensive and complex knowledge in all fields of energy within the framework of sustainable development.
The Master programme "Sustainable Energy Systems" is offered by the Department of Mechanical Engineering of University of West Attica.

Learning Outcomes

SES innovation lies in the synthesis of technological, techno-economic and environmental parameters and success determinants of future sustainable energy projects. For this purpose, the thematic fields of the SES programme extends are:
1. Technologies of Renewable Energy Sources
2. Design of Sustainable Energy Systems
3. Economy and Entrepreneurship in the field of Sustainable Energy
